**Ticket: Config drift on BounceSift processor**

The email bounce processor in the Larkfield environment has drifted from the values committed in the release branch. Retry windows and suppression thresholds no longer match, which likely explains the duplicate suppression entries reported Tuesday. Please reconcile before the Thursday cut. For reference, the currently deployed configuration on the live node reads as follows.

config for yajep-yahof:
[briax]
port = 9200
region = outer-2
host = briax.nelvrocorp.test
team = raleth
timeout_ms = 1500
retries = 1

Handover: SQL lint rules, Fernbright pipeline. Moved from custom regex checks to the Stelkline linter. Rules now enforce uppercase keywords, no SELECT *, and mandatory trailing semicolons. CI fails hard on violations; no warnings tier. Legacy files under /archive are exempt until Q3. Release manager should verify the gate before cutting. Active linter settings follow below:

service settings:
[casax]
port = 6379
team = rusir
host = casax.zemvarhq.corp
region = outer-4
access_code = ac_9808ce
timeout_ms = 1500

Finance Review Summary — Second-Source Supplier Search. The team assessed three candidate suppliers for the Veltrix resin line, comparing landed cost, payment terms, and tooling commitments. Quotations from Arnholt Polymers and Cressmere Industrial remain within budget tolerance. A final recommendation follows diligence on capacity. The confidential direction below informs our negotiating stance.

management briefing: Jorixax Holdings is in early talks to buy Casixax Holdings for about $420.3 million. The Fenmir launch date is October 27, and nothing goes to the press before then. Legal wants the Keloxek Foods term sheet redrafted before April 16.

## Deployment

Invoicewright renders PDF invoices for all Lanternbay billing flows. Deploys go out through the standard pipeline; the renderer is stateless, so rolling restarts are safe at any time. Font bundles ship inside the container image, so no shared volume is needed. Before your first deploy, confirm the staging worker count matches production. The service reads the following configuration at startup.

settings of tagef-bawif:
DRUIX_HOST=druix.zemvarlabs.internal
DRUIX_PORT=8000